How It All Started (With a Pint and a Quiz)
It all began back in 2006 in the Rose and Crown pub in Stratford-upon-Avon. One evening, I was with a friend, having a few drinks and, as usual, losing spectacularly at the weekly pub quiz. When the landlord announced there'd be no quiz the following week, we half-drunkenly volunteered to host it ourselves. The fool said yes.
That first quiz night led to being asked if we'd fancy doing a disco for New Year's Eve. We said "why not?", got a small bank loan, bought some kit, and threw ourselves into our first proper gig. Like anything you do for the first time, it was absolutely rubbish – but it was good fun, and we kept at it.
My partner in crime dropped out after a few years, but I was hooked. Nearly 20 years on, I've done pretty much every type of event you can imagine (except funerals – whilst I understand the concept, I'd feel deeply uncomfortable, so that's where I draw the line).
